The right candidate will bring excellent customer service and appropriate skills to their role Some of your responsibilities will include:
- Promptly and professionally answers telephone calls. Routes calls appropriately, offering voice mail or redirection of calls as necessary.
- Greets patients and assists them as appropriate.
- Explains financial requirements to the patients or responsible parties and collects copays as required.
- Answers telephone screens calls, takes messages, and provides information.
- Obtains, verifies, and updates patient information, including insurance coverage, and provides support services to patients and medical staff.
- Requests, locates, sends and receives patient medical records.
- Schedules appointments for patients either by phone when they call or in person after an office visit.
- Ensures updates (e.g. cancellations or additions) are input daily into master schedule.
- Use customer service principles and techniques to deal with patients calmly and pleasantly.
